The discussion critiques Kamala Harris's recent acceptance of the Democratic nomination, questioning her authenticity and political strategy. It highlights the disconnect between media adoration and her questionable performance on key issues. The hosts mock the celebrity focus in political narratives, emphasizing a lack of substantive policy discussion. They also dissect Harris's ambiguous messaging on critical topics like immigration and national security, while drawing contrasts with Donald Trump’s more direct approach.
